
Caso você queira conferir tente usar a função do pacote EXPDES.pt::dic(trata,respo,quali=c(TRUE),mcomp="sk"). Tente executar seu comando da seguinte forma: sk1<-with(dad,SK(y=respo, model="respo~trata",which="trata")) Att. Tiago. ################################################################# Tiago de Souza Marçal - Graduando em Agronomia pelo CCA-UFES Bolsista de Iniciação Científica da área de Genética e Melhoramento de Plantas ################################################################# Date: Mon, 2 Dec 2013 17:39:25 -0800 From: andreolsouza@yahoo.com.br To: r-br@listas.c3sl.ufpr.br Subject: [R-br] ScottKnott Pessoal depois de pesquisar na grupo e no manual da função ainda não resolvi o que quero. Estou com esta estrutura.
setwd("/media/Meus arquivos/Pendrive/KINGSTON/sweave/apostilaR2")> require(gdata)> dad<-read.xls("dic.xls")> str(dad)'data.frame': 12 obs. of 3 variables: $ trata: Factor w/ 4 levels "A","B","C","D": 1 1 1 2 2 2 3 3 3 4 ... $ rep : int 1 2 3 1 2 3 1 2 3 1 ... $ respo: int 6 14 4 9 10 8 73 22 10 1 ...> attach(dad)> dad trata rep respo1 A 1 62 A 2 143 A 3 44 B 1 95 B 2 106 B 3 87 C 1 738 C 2 229 C 3 1010 D 1 111 D 2 1012 D 3 4> library(doBy)> summaryBy(respo~trata,dad,FUN=c(mean,sd)) trata respo.mean respo.sd1 A 8 5.2915032 B 9 1.0000003 C 35 33.4514574 D 5 4.582576> require(ScottKnott)> sk1<-SK(dad,y=respo,model="respo~trata",which="trata")> summary(sk1) Levels Means SK(5%) C 35 a B 9 a A 8 a D 5 a> plot(sk1, title = "Treatamentos", col = rainbow(3)) média iguais ? Minha pergunta é o que fiz de errado? Declarei o modelo errado? o correto seria sk1<-SK(x=dad,y=respo,model="respo~trata",which="trata")? Não mudou nada na resposta summary(sk1) Levels Means SK(5%) C 35 a B 9 a A 8 a D 5 a obrigado
_______________________________________________ R-br mailing list R-br@listas.c3sl.ufpr.br https://listas.inf.ufpr.br/cgi-bin/mailman/listinfo/r-br Leia o guia de postagem (http://www.leg.ufpr.br/r-br-guia) e forne�a c�digo m�nimo reproduz�vel.